A newly discovered vulnerability, CVE-2025-1916, has sent shockwaves through the cybersecurity community, particularly affecting Chromium-based browsers like Microsoft Edge. This critical use-after-free flaw could allow attackers to execute arbitrary code or crash browsers, putting millions of Windows users at risk.

What is CVE-2025-1916?

CVE-2025-1916 is a high-severity vulnerability (CVSS score: 8.8) in the Chromium engine that powers Microsoft Edge, Google Chrome, and other browsers. The flaw exists in the browser's memory management system, specifically involving improper handling of objects in memory (a use-after-free condition). When exploited, this vulnerability could:

  • Allow remote code execution
  • Cause browser crashes (denial of service)
  • Potentially lead to system compromise

Technical Breakdown of the Vulnerability

The vulnerability stems from how Chromium handles certain DOM objects during page navigation. When a web page containing malicious JavaScript triggers specific sequences of DOM operations followed by navigation, it can cause the browser to:

  1. Create and reference DOM objects
  2. Navigate to a new page
  3. Attempt to access freed memory
  4. Execute attacker-controlled code

Security researchers have identified that the vulnerability is particularly dangerous when combined with other exploits in a chain attack.

Impact on Microsoft Edge Users

As Microsoft Edge is built on the Chromium engine, all current versions are affected. The vulnerability impacts:

  • Edge versions 120 through 124 (stable channel)
  • Edge Beta and Dev channel builds
  • Enterprise deployments of Microsoft Edge

Microsoft has confirmed that attackers could exploit this vulnerability by convincing users to visit a specially crafted website, requiring no additional user interaction beyond initial page load.

Mitigation and Patch Status

Microsoft and the Chromium team have been working on patches since the vulnerability was reported through their bug bounty program. Current recommendations include:

  • Immediate action: Update to Edge version 125 or later once available
  • Temporary workaround: Enable Enhanced Security Mode in Edge settings
  • Enterprise controls: Deploy Microsoft Defender Application Guard for Edge

Timeline of the Vulnerability

  • Discovery: January 2025 by independent security researchers
  • Reported: February 3, 2025 to Chromium security team
  • Acknowledgement: February 10, 2025 by Microsoft Security Response Center
  • Patch expected: March 2025 cumulative update

Best Practices for Protection

While waiting for the official patch, users should:

  1. Avoid visiting untrusted websites
  2. Disable unnecessary JavaScript
  3. Use browser sandboxing features
  4. Monitor for unusual browser behavior
  5. Keep all security software updated

The Bigger Picture: Chromium's Security Challenges

This vulnerability highlights ongoing challenges with:

  • Memory safety in large C++ codebases
  • The shared risk model of Chromium-based browsers
  • The increasing sophistication of browser-based attacks

Security experts note that while Chromium's rapid release cycle helps address vulnerabilities quickly, the shared codebase means flaws often affect multiple browsers simultaneously.

What Enterprises Need to Know

For organizations using Microsoft Edge:

  • Review your patch management strategy
  • Consider temporary use of Application Control policies
  • Monitor for exploit attempts in web traffic logs
  • Educate employees about the risks

Microsoft has indicated they will provide additional guidance through their security advisories as more information becomes available.

Looking Ahead

The discovery of CVE-2025-1916 serves as another reminder of the constant cat-and-mouse game in browser security. As Chromium continues to dominate the browser market share, its security model will remain under intense scrutiny from both researchers and malicious actors alike.